Texas Compression is a Houston-based mechanical and Industrial services contractor servicing customer across Texas, Louisiana and Oklahoma. We are currently looking for experienced local coating technicians for upcoming projects located in Harris, Galveston, Fort Bend and Brazoria Counties. Job duties include but are not limited to: Surface preparation of various substrates using pressure wash, hand preparation, mechanical preparation and abrasive blast methods. Properly mix and apply specialty coatings using brush, roller and spray methods. Apply composite repair and specialty wrap systems. Perform general plant maintenance. Maintain accurate record keeping on work performed. Qualifications: 2+ years previous experience is required as an industrial blaster / painter. NACE CIP1 Certification or NCCER Task 7.1 thru 7.7 with performance Verifications. (NCCER Modules 61106 / 61207 / 61208 / 61206) Preferred. Candidates must be comfortable working in abnormal operating conditions which consist of but are not limited to confined spaces or environments that pose immediate danger to life and health. Candidates must be comfortable working in highly regulated, detail-oriented environment where strict adherence to rules and procedures are always required Requirement: High School Diploma or GED Required. Must have a valid driver's license and be able to pass our Driver Certification Program. Must be able to Read, Write and Speak English Fluently. 2 years' experience minimum. Clear drug and alcohol screen. Clear background check. TWIC, Basic + Must have reliable transportation Able to carry up to 100 pounds. Must be able to work 10-12+ hours Days.
